  • Patent number: 9387613
    Abstract: A semiconductor package formation arrangement includes a mold housing with an interior cavity having top, bottom and first and second end sides. A gate for transferring liquefied molding material extends to the first end side. A lead frame having a top surface, a rear surface opposite the top surface and a mold flow modifier forms a first cavity section between the top surface and the top side and a second cavity section between the rear surface and the bottom side. A topology of the lead frame causes liquefied molding material to fill the first and second cavity sections at different rates. The mold flow modifier extends away from the lead frame so as to compensate for the difference between the first and second rates.

  • Publication number: 20060064702
    Abstract: The invention relates to an apparatus for reading or writing information on a circular information carrier (D) having a periphery, said apparatus comprising a turntable (501) for clamping and rotating said information carrier (D), said information carrier (D) having an initial tilt from the radial direction of the turntable. The apparatus comprises additional means for applying an end load at the periphery of said information carrier, so as to apply a tilt of known value to said information carrier with respect to the radial direction of the turntable (501), said known value being larger than said initial tilt. The clamping surface of the turntable (501) may be tilted appropriately.

  • Publication number: 20030067664
    Abstract: An optical unit (10) for an optical scanning device includes a one-piece component (18) having a built-in beam splitter (14) and built-in portions configured to house a radiation source (20) and a radiation-sensitive detector (22). The optical unit has a good radiation efficiency and is small and light-weight. The one-piece component may be made of glass or a transparent plastic material and may also comprise a diffraction grating (16) and an objective lens (12).
